Toffee Bars

Ingredients
- 1 cup butter or margarine, softened
- 1 cup packed brown sugar
- 1 tsp. vanilla
- 1 large egg yolk
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- ¼ tsp. salt
- ⅔ cup milk chocolate chips or 3 bars (1.55 oz. each) milk chocolate, broken into small pieces
- ½ cup chopped nuts
Steps
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ees.
- In a large bowl, stir the butter, brown sugar, vanilla, and egg yolk until well mixed. Stir in the flour and salt. Press the dough into a greased 9-by-13-inch pan.
- Bake 25 to 30 minutes or until very light brown (the crust will be soft). Immediately sprinkle the chocolate chips over the hot crust. Let stand about 5 minutes or until soft; spread the chocolate evenly. Sprinkle with the nuts.
- Cool 30 minutes in the pan on a wire rack. To cut into bars easily, cut into 8 rows by 4 rows while still warm.
Note
If using self-rising flour, omit the salt.
